当前位置: 代码迷 >> Java Web开发 >> 回答给分,动态创建的input checkbox 该如何取值,即判断是否选中
??详细解决方案

回答给分,动态创建的input checkbox 该如何取值,即判断是否选中

热度:2315???发布时间:2013-02-25 21:17:52.0
回答给分,动态创建的input checkbox 该怎么取值,即判断是否选中。
循环
function mytest(){
$.post("/TaskManSystem/jsps/findAllRole.action",{},function(json){
var tbl = createTbl();
for(var i=0;i<>
tbl = tbl +createData(json.roleMap[i].role_id,json.roleMap[i].role_number,json.roleMap[i].role_name,json.roleMap[i].role_time,json.roleMap[i].role_descript,json.roleMap[i].role_status);
//alert(json.roleMap[i].role_status);
}
tbl = tbl +"";

$("#data")(tbl);
// changeInput();
},"json")
}

判断
//判断是否有效
if(role_status==1){
alert(role_status.length);
tr=tr+"有效无效";

}else{
tr= tr+ "有效无效";
}

这样的话只是最后一个才有是否选中,其他的全都没有,求指点。

------解决方案--------------------------------------------------------
兄弟 你那个在循环里面吗
------解决方案--------------------------------------------------------
兄弟,使用循环给name赋值,让name值不同,再用循环取值就好了
??相关解决方案
本站暂不开放注册!
内测阶段只得通过邀请码进行注册!
?
  • 最近登录:Sat Oct 19 13:51:54 CST 2019
  • 最近登录:Sat Oct 19 13:51:54 CST 2019
  • 最近登录:Sat Oct 19 13:51:54 CST 2019
  • 最近登录:Sat Oct 19 13:51:54 CST 2019
  • 最近登录:Sat Oct 19 13:51:54 CST 2019